The Exeter Family Music Center classes are hosted by the Exeter Parks and Recreation Department
Our mission is to honor, embrace and develop the creative spirit of the child with informal enrichment opportunities in Music, Art and Performing Arts.
All classes, workshops, programs, and camps are designed to be developmentally appropriate and fun for children. Each child is appreciated for and taught to their personal learning style, personality, readiness, creativity and enthusiasm. We respect and honor the natural creative process while giving the children rich opportunities to develop skills and confidence.
Younger children enjoy Music Together® Classes with a caregiver present, while older children get involved in the music making with Kindergarten Enrichment or Music for 5 - 9 year olds.
Once readiness is assessed, it's on to Piano, Voice or Violin, group or individual classes.
Parents can also enjoy Mommy/Daddy Guitar class!
Teachers can create a one day workshop for all your teachers Pre-K -3rd grade or sign up for a personal development session taught in your classroom each week.
Additional program include Elementary School Multicultural workshops with themes of Peace or the Environment, and our wonderful Summer Camps. Check out photos of this year's Little Princess Camp 2009 or our Sing Alongs.
